在安卓应用开发中,为了确保应用的安全性和稳定性,开发者需要为其申请相应的证书,这些证书包括:开发者账号、应用签名证书、系统权限证书等,应用签名证书是用于对应用进行签名的,以确保应用的完整性和真实性,本文将介绍安卓未获取证书时APP特征信息及其获取方式。
未获取证书的APP特征信息
1、无法安装:未获取证书的应用无法正常安装到手机上,用户在尝试安装时会收到“安装失败”的提示。
2、无法更新:未获取证书的应用在有新版本发布时,用户无法正常更新,需要重新下载安装包。
3、安全性低:未获取证书的应用可能存在安全隐患,如恶意代码、病毒等,给用户带来潜在风险。
4、功能受限:部分功能受限,如访问系统权限、使用网络、读写外部存储等。
5、用户体验差:由于无法正常使用应用的功能,用户在使用过程中可能会遇到各种问题,导致用户体验下降。
获取安卓应用证书的方式
1、注册开发者账号:首先需要在谷歌开发者控制台(Google Developer Console)注册一个开发者账号,注册过程中需要提供个人或企业的信息,以及支付相应的费用。
2、创建应用:在开发者控制台中创建一个新应用,填写应用的基本信息,如应用名称、包名、图标等。
3、生成密钥:为应用生成一对公钥和私钥,用于后续的应用签名过程,可以在开发者控制台中选择“创建新的密钥”,然后下载生成的公钥和私钥文件。
4、申请应用签名证书:在开发者控制台中申请一个应用签名证书,需要提供应用的SHA1指纹等信息,申请成功后,系统会自动生成一个应用签名证书文件。
5、上传应用签名证书:将生成的应用签名证书文件上传到开发者控制台,以便后续的应用签名过程。
6、使用密钥对应用进行签名:使用之前生成的密钥对应用进行签名,确保应用的完整性和真实性,可以使用Android Studio等开发工具进行签名操作。
7、发布应用:完成应用签名后,可以将应用发布到谷歌商店或其他安卓应用市场,供用户下载和使用。
相关问答FAQs
Q1:为什么需要为安卓应用申请证书?
A1:为安卓应用申请证书是为了确保应用的安全性和稳定性,通过证书对应用进行签名,可以验证应用的完整性和真实性,防止恶意代码、病毒等对用户的侵害,证书还可以限制应用的功能,如访问系统权限、使用网络等,确保用户在使用过程中的安全。
Q2:如何查看已发布的安卓应用的证书信息?
A2:在谷歌开发者控制台中,可以查看已发布的安卓应用的证书信息,具体操作步骤如下:
1、登录谷歌开发者控制台,进入“我的应用”页面。
2、找到需要查看证书信息的应用,点击进入“设置”页面。
3、在“设置”页面中,点击“高级”选项卡。
4、在“高级”选项卡中,可以看到“证书”部分,显示了该应用的证书信息,包括证书类型、有效期等。
为安卓应用申请证书是确保应用安全和稳定的重要环节,开发者需要了解未获取证书的APP特征信息,掌握获取安卓应用证书的方式,以便为用户提供安全、稳定的应用体验,开发者还需要关注安卓平台的政策变化,及时更新和应用相关的证书信息,确保应用的正常运行。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/679124.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复